Output 13d81e3c4b4a19d98bdac851bf5fb6684bb9fd9057403542fb4080b9a270f766:0

value
529450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d746dbf6d428f9029d0a0dd392485fbfa5708851 OP_EQUAL
address
3MKJ6B16VPGu1uZuX9D3xCAyswWq5WwyLH
transaction
13d81e3c4b4a19d98bdac851bf5fb6684bb9fd9057403542fb4080b9a270f766